Details of IFSC Code for Indusind Bank, Babanpur, Fatehabad
The table below shows the main details of the IFSC Code INDB0001349 for the Indusind Bank branch in Fatehabad, which falls under the Babanpur district in Haryana.
| Particulars | Details |
|---|---|
| Bank | Indusind Bank |
| IFSC Code | INDB0001349 |
| Branch | Babanpur |
| City | Fatehabad |
| District | Babanpur |
| State | Haryana |
| Address | Indusind Bank Ltd Vill Babanpur Tehsil Ratia Distt Fatehabad Haryana 125051 |

Format of the IFSC Code INDB0001349
This is the format of the IFSC Code for banks, including Indusind Bank, follows an 11-character structure:
AAAA0CCCCCC
Here's the explanation:
- First 4 characters (AAAA): This is the bank code. For Indusind Bank, these characters are the bank's short identifier.
- 5th character (0): This stays zero till there is any future use.
- Last 6 characters (CCCCCC): These are specific branch code assigned to branches such as Babanpur in Fatehabad.
For example, the IFSC Code INDB0001349 of Indusind Bank for the Babanpur branch includes these elements, identifying the bank and the branch location in Fatehabad and Haryana accurately.

How to Use IFSC Code INDB0001349 for Online Transfers?
Once you have the IFSC Code INDB0001349 for the Babanpur branch of Indusind Bank in Fatehabad, you can initiate your fund transfers using any digital method:
NEFT
Add the beneficiary's name, account number, and IFSC Code INDB0001349. The transfer is completed in batches instead of instantly. It is useful for both personal and business payments.
RTGS
Used for high-value payments above ₹2 lakh. Real-time settlement using the IFSC Code of the recipient branch.
IMPS
Instant 24×7 transfers. Requires the recipient's account details and Indusind Bank IFSC Code INDB0001349.
No matter which payment method you use, the IFSC Code must be correct. If you enter the wrong IFSC Code for the Indusind Bank Babanpur in Fatehabad, your payment can get delayed or might not go through at all.
